N-苯丙烯酰氨基酸类化合物的研究进展

Research Progress in N-Phenylpropenoyl-L-amino Acids

  • 摘要: N-苯丙烯酰氨基酸类化合物是氨基酸的N-苯丙烯酰化产物,具有抗氧化、抗微生物、抑制酪氨酸酶、抑制α-葡萄糖苷酶和抗神经炎症等多方面的活性。在医药、食品和化妆品等领域具有良好的应用前景。综述N-苯丙烯酰氨基酸类化合物的合成方法和药理活性研究进展,旨在为该类化合物的构效关系深入研究和开发应用提供参考。

     

    Abstract: N-phenylpropenoyl-L-amino acids(NPAs) are phenylpropenoyled products of amino acids with multiple pharmacological activities, such as anti-oxidative, anti-microbial, tyrosinase-inhibiting, α-glucosidase-inhibiting, and anti-neuroinflammatory activities. NPAs have very promising application prospect in the fields of medicine, food and cosmetics. This paper reviewed recent advances in synthetic methods and pharmacological activities of NPAs, so as to provide references for further study of their structure-activity relationship and development of NPAs.
